POSITION PURPOSE
A Business Risk Analyst is sought for the EMEA region (including UK), based in London and reporting to the Senior Business Risk Manager EMEA. The EMEA Business Risk team is part of Enterprise Risk Management department, which sits in the second line of defence in the firm's 'Three Lines of Defence' risk management model.
This role will be highly visible, requiring interaction with stakeholders across all business functions, products, markets, services, technologies, and business policies/practices. The individual must be an independent, self-starter who is able challenge senior management constructively and effectively. In addition to EMEA stakeholders, the individual will partner with global risk counterparts and contribute to developing and embedding the risk management framework and methodologies. Key responsibilities include involvement in the preparation for senior risk committees, the Individual Capital Adequacy and Risk Assessment ("ICARA") and the Wind Down Plan for the T. Rowe Price International Ltd (TRPIL) entity.
